소개:DeepDocs는 GitHub AI 에이전트로, README, API 참조, SDK 가이드, 튜토리얼 등과 같은 문서를 변화하는 코드베이스에 맞춰 자동으로 최신 상태로 유지하여 수동 작업을 없애줍니다.
등록일:7/24/2025
링크:
DeepDocs screenshot

DeepDocs이란?

DeepDocs는 진화하는 코드베이스와 기술 문서를 동기화하는 프로세스를 자동화하려는 개발 팀을 위해 설계된 GitHub 네이티브 AI 에이전트입니다. 이 에이전트는 코드 변경 사항을 자동으로 스캔하고 README, API 참조, SDK 가이드, 튜토리얼과 같은 관련 문서를 업데이트하여 오래된 문서 문제를 해결합니다. DeepDocs의 핵심 가치는 수동적이고 시간이 많이 소요되는 문서 업데이트 작업을 없애 개발자가 코드 출하에 집중하면서 문서의 정확성과 최신 상태를 유지할 수 있도록 하는 것입니다. GitHub 워크플로에 직접 통합되어 지능적이고 개인 정보 보호를 우선하는 업데이트를 제공합니다.

DeepDocs 사용 방법

사용자는 GitHub Marketplace에서 DeepDocs 앱을 자신의 저장소에 설치하여 시작할 수 있습니다. 설치 후, 저장소 루트에 있는 `deepdocs.yml` 파일에 추적할 문서 파일 또는 폴더를 정의하여 DeepDocs를 구성해야 합니다. 이 YAML 파일을 커밋하면 초기 딥 스캔이 트리거되고 별도의 브랜치에서 오래된 문서가 업데이트됩니다. 이후 모든 코드 커밋은 지속적인 문서 업데이트를 자동으로 트리거합니다. DeepDocs는 개인 또는 오픈 소스 프로젝트를 위한 제한된 크레딧의 무료 플랜을 제공하며, 더 많은 크레딧과 기능을 포함하는 'Pro' 플랜이 곧 출시될 예정입니다.

DeepDocs의 주요 기능

지속적인 문서화

딥 스캔

지능형 업데이트

상세 보고서

GitHub 네이티브

개인 정보 보호 우선

DeepDocs의 사용 사례

코드 변경 시 README 파일을 자동으로 업데이트합니다.

API 코드 수정 사항에 맞춰 API 참조 문서를 동기화합니다.

SDK 가이드가 최신 라이브러리 버전 및 기능을 반영하도록 보장합니다.

기본 코드가 진화함에 따라 최신 튜토리얼을 유지합니다.

개발 팀의 수동 문서 업데이트를 없앱니다.

단일 스캔으로 전체 저장소의 문서 정확성을 보장합니다.

기존 GitHub 워크플로에 문서 업데이트를 원활하게 통합합니다.

코드 커밋으로 인한 문서 변경 사항에 대한 명확한 보고서를 제공합니다.

DeepDocs에 대한 자주 묻는 질문

DeepDocs는 어떤 기능을 하나요?

DeepDocs는 GitHub 네이티브 AI 에이전트로, API 문서, SDK 가이드, 튜토리얼 등을 코드베이스와 자동으로 동기화합니다. 코드 변경 사항을 감지하고, 오래된 문서를 찾아내며, 상세 보고서와 함께 별도의 브랜치에서 업데이트를 수행합니다.

DeepDocs가 문서를 처음부터 생성하나요?

DeepDocs는 기존 문서를 유지 관리하도록 설계되었으며, 처음부터 생성하지는 않습니다. 문서가 전혀 없는 상태에서 시작하는 경우, GitHub Copilot, Cursor 등과 같은 AI 코드 도구가 초기 버전을 작성하는 데 도움을 줄 수 있습니다. 문서가 일단 준비되면 DeepDocs는 모든 커밋마다 자동으로 업데이트하여 코드베이스와 동기화 상태를 유지합니다.

제 저장소에 DeepDocs를 어떻게 설정할 수 있나요?

DeepDocs는 세 가지 간단한 단계로 설정할 수 있습니다: 1. GitHub Marketplace에서 앱을 설치합니다; 2. deepdocs.yml 파일에 추적하려는 대상 문서 파일 또는 폴더를 지정합니다; 3. 저장소 루트에 파일을 커밋하여 딥 스캔을 트리거하고 손상된 문서를 업데이트합니다. 향후 커밋은 문서 업데이트를 자동으로 트리거합니다.

DeepDocs가 제 문서 구조나 스타일을 변경하나요?

아니요. DeepDocs는 문서의 관련 부분만 지능적으로 업데이트합니다. 기존 형식을 보존하며 파일을 처음부터 다시 작성하지 않습니다.

딥 스캔과 문서 업데이트의 차이점은 무엇인가요?

딥 스캔은 DeepDocs 기능으로, 저장소 전체를 분석하여 오래된 문서를 한 번에 감지하고 수정하는 기능이며 수동으로 트리거할 수 있습니다. 문서 업데이트는 모든 커밋에서 트리거되는 지속적인 문서화 기능으로, 영향을 받는 문서만 식별하고 업데이트합니다.

DeepDocs에서 크레딧은 어떻게 소모되나요?

DeepDocs는 딥 스캔에 1크레딧, 문서 업데이트 프로세스에 1크레딧을 사용합니다.

Cursor나 Copilot 같은 AI 코딩 에이전트도 문서를 생성할 수 있지 않나요?

그럴 수 있지만, 수동으로 업데이트할 내용을 프롬프트해야만 가능합니다. DeepDocs는 다르게 작동합니다. CI/CD가 수동 배포를 대체했듯이, DeepDocs는 수동 문서 업데이트를 대체하여 워크플로에 지속적인 문서화를 제공합니다. 또한 전체 코드-문서 컨텍스트를 사용하여 어떤 내용이 변경되었고 어떤 문서가 영향을 받는지 프롬프트 없이도 알 수 있습니다.